The Mid-Hudson Library System and the Tempestry Project are recruiting Hudson Valley knitters to create fiber art that visualizes regional climate change from 1895 to 2025.
By Chronogram Staff
The Mid-Hudson Library System (MHLS) is marking Earth Month with the launch of a new community-driven art initiative in collaboration with the Tempestry Project. The partnership seeks to transform climate data into tangible, local storytelling through fiber arts, inviting more than 100 knitters across the Hudson Valley to participate in creating a collective visual record of climate change.…
